The resolution, introduced by Representative Concepcion and Senator Duff, seeks to confirm the nomination of David A. Arconti, Jr. from Brookfield as a utility commissioner for the Public Utilities Regulatory Authority. This appointment is made by the Governor and is set to last until March 1, 2028, or until a successor is appointed and qualified, whichever period is longer.

The resolution has been referred to the Committee on Executive and Legislative Nominations for further consideration. If approved, Arconti will take on responsibilities related to the regulation of public utilities in the state, contributing to the oversight and management of utility services.
